Understanding the Breitling A25363: The Bentley Motors Special Edition
The Breitling for Bentley Motors Special Edition, designated by the A25363 reference number, is a chronograph that embodies the spirit of both Breitling's precision engineering and Bentley's luxurious automotive design. It's more than just a watch; it's a statement piece, a symbol of craftsmanship, and a testament to the collaborative efforts of two iconic brands.
Key features of the genuine Breitling A25363 include:
* Chronograph Function: This is a core element of the watch, allowing for precise timing with subdials measuring elapsed time.breitling a25363 real or fake
* Date Display: Typically located at the 6 o'clock position, the date window provides an essential everyday function.
* Automatic Movement: The A25363 houses a high-quality automatic movement, ensuring accuracy and reliability. It's often based on a Valjoux 7750 movement, modified and refined by Breitling.
* Distinctive Bezel: The bezel often features a knurled design reminiscent of Bentley radiator grilles, a key aesthetic link between the watch and the car brand.
* Premium Materials: High-grade stainless steel or gold (depending on the specific version) is used for the case, bracelet, and other components.
* High-Quality Finish: The case, dial, and hands are meticulously finished to Breitling's exacting standards, exhibiting a level of detail and refinement that's difficult to replicate in a fake.

The Authentication Checklist: A Step-by-Step Guide
Now, let's get down to the nitty-gritty of authentication. This checklist covers the key areas to examine when assessing the authenticity of a Breitling A25363.
1. The Dial: A Window to Authenticity
The dial is often the first place counterfeiters cut corners. Pay close attention to the following:
* Font and Printing: Examine the font used for the Breitling logo, model name, and other markings. Is it crisp, clear, and consistent? Counterfeits often have blurry, uneven, or incorrectly spaced text.
* Subdials: The subdials should be perfectly aligned and the hands should move smoothly and precisely. Check the functionality of the chronograph; does it start, stop, and reset correctly?
* Lume: The luminous material on the hands and hour markers should glow evenly and brightly in the dark. Fake watches often have weak or uneven lume.
* Date Window: The date should be centered in the window and the font should match the original. The date wheel should change crisply and precisely at midnight.
* "Bentley" Logo and Details: Scrutinize the Bentley logo and any other details specific to the Bentley Motors Special Edition. Are they accurately rendered and properly placed? Counterfeiters often make mistakes in these areas.
